3. Job Set-up
Subtask 32-11-17-941-052-A
A. Safety Precautions
   (1) Make sure that the SAFETY BARRIER(S) are in position.
   (2) Make sure that a WARNING NOTICE(S) is on the ground service connection to tell persons not to pressurize:
  • The Green hydraulic system
  • The Yellow hydraulic system.
   (3) On panel 400VU:
  • Make sure that the landing-gear control-lever 6GA is in the DOWN position
  • Make sure that the WARNING NOTICE(S) is in position to tell persons not to operate the landing gear.
Subtask 32-11-17-860-054-A
B. Aircraft Maintenance Configuration
   (1) Make sure that the ACCESS PLATFORM 2M (6 FT) is below the applicable MLG lockstay at zone 731 or 741.
   (2) Make sure that the aircraft is lifted on jacks (Ref. AMM TASK 07-11-00-581-001).
   (3) Make sure that the applicable hydraulic systems are depressurized (Ref. AMM TASK 29-00-00-864-001).
   (4) Make sure that the applicable hydraulic reservoirs are depressurized (Ref. AMM TASK 29-14-00-614-001).
   (5) Make sure that the isolation coupling of the PTU is disconnected (Ref. AMM TASK 29-23-00-860-001).

C. Installation of the MLG Lock Stay
   (1) Make sure that the side stay is safetied in position, the weight of the side stay is 54.8 kg (120.8 lb).
   (2) Hold and align the lock-stay eye end (18) with the cardan joint.
   (3) Install the spacers (1), the washer (17), the pin (16), the washer (19) and the nut (20).
NOTE: Install the pin (16) with the head of the pin aft.
   (4) Align the lower lock-link with the side-stay attachment lugs and install these parts:
  • The washers (38)
  • The washer (39)
  • The pin (40), with the head of the pin aft
  • The washer (48)
  • The nut (47).
   (5) Align the lockspring link with the lug on the lower lock-link and install these parts:
  • The washers (42)
  • The pin (41), with the head of the pin aft
  • The washer (43)
  • The nut (45).
   (6) TORQUE the nut (20) to between 4.2 and 3.6 m.daN (30.97 and 26.55 lbf.ft ) T. Tighten the nut (20), no more than 4.2 m.daN (30.97 lbf.ft) to align the cotter-pin hole.
   (7) Safety the nut (20) with a new
AIPC 32-11-17-01-150 COTTER-PIN (21).
   (8) TORQUE the nut (47) to between 4.2 and 3.6 m.daN (30.97 and 26.55 lbf.ft )
T and safety with a new AIPC 32-11-18-01-080 COTTER-PIN (46).
   (9) TORQUE the nut (45) to between 0.95 and 0.8 m.daN (84.07 and 70.80 lbf.in )
T and safety with a new AIPC 32-11-18-01-030 COTTER-PIN (44).
   (10) Remove the safety device from the lock-stay actuating-cylinder.
   (11) Align the lock-stay actuating-cylinder eye-end with the actuating-cylinder attachment lugs and install these parts:
  • The washers (37)
  • The washer (32)
  • The pin (33), with the head of the pin aft
  • The washer (34)
  • The nut (35).
   (12) TORQUE the nut (35) to between 0.7 and 0.46 m.daN (61.95 and 40.71 lbf.in )
T and safety with a new AIPC 32-11-17-01-030 COTTER-PIN (36).
   (13) Remove the safety device from the side stay.
   (14) Connect the locksprings at the top attachment (
Ref. AMM TASK 32-11-19-400-003).
   (15) Put the clips (11) on the electrical cable (9) and put the electrical cable (9) on the bracket (8).
   (16) Install the washers (12) and the bolts (13).
   (17) Remove the blanking caps and connect the electrical cable (9) to the proximity sensor (7).
   (18) Do the dimensional check of the proximity sensors on the lock stay (Ref. AMM TASK 32-31-73-200-001).
   (19) Apply Polysulfide Sealant-General Purpose Fillet - (Material No.06AAB1) to:
  • The ends of the cardan joint
  • The ends of the pins (16), (40), (41) and (33)
  • The nuts (3), (6), (20), (25), (31), (45), (47) and (35)
  • The washers (2), (5), (17), (19), (26), (30), (39), (43), (48), (32) and (34)
  • The heads of the bolts (10), (14) and (15).
   (20) Use Synthetic Ester base Grease-General Purpose Low Temp - (Material No.03HBD9) or Synthetic Oil base Grease-General Purpose Clay Thickened - (Material No.03GBB1) or Synthetic Oil base Grease-Landing Gear Wheel Bearing Lithium Thickened - (Material No.03GCB1) to lubricate the lock-stay through the greasers.
NOTE: For lubricant grease specification and lubrication requirements, refer to (Ref. AMM D/O 12-22-00-00).
